Montreal Comiccon Sees a Surge in Attendance Due to US Entertainment Industry Turmoil

Montreal Comiccon, a highly anticipated annual event for comic book, science fiction, horror, anime, and gaming enthusiasts, has experienced a significant boost in attendance, and a spokesperson attributes this surge to the ongoing conflicts and uncertainties within the United States' entertainment industry. The event, held annually in Montreal, Canada, has become a major draw for fans and industry professionals alike, offering a diverse range of activities, including panels, workshops, autograph sessions, and a bustling exhibitor hall. The recent increase in attendance underscores Montreal Comiccon's growing reputation as a premier destination for pop culture enthusiasts, and its ability to capitalize on the shifting dynamics within the entertainment landscape.
